What is Cyan 4?

Cyan 4 is the cyan-4 reference in the Open Color. Its sRGB value is #3BC9DB (rgb 59, 201, 219). It sits in the cyan family. Open Color, an open-source color palette by Heeyeun designed for UI work. 13 hues across 10 shades (0 to 9) tuned for screen legibility and accessibility. FAQ about Cyan 4

What is the HEX code for Cyan 4?

Cyan 4 (cyan-4) has the HEX code #3BC9DB. In RGB it is rgb(59, 201, 219), and in CMYK it is cmyk(73%, 8%, 0%, 14%).

What is the OKLCH value of Cyan 4?

Cyan 4 converts to oklch(0.770 0.119 207.6). OKLCH is the perceptually uniform color space used by Tailwind v4 and CSS Color Module Level 4.

Is Cyan 4 accessible for body text?

Used as a background, Cyan 4 has a contrast ratio of 10.56:1 with black text and 1.99:1 with white text. WCAG 2.1 AA requires 4.5:1 for normal text. The current recommendation is to use black text and verify in real UI context.

What is the closest Pantone to Cyan 4?

The closest Pantone reference to Cyan 4 by ΔE2000 perceptual distance is Pantone 3115 C (#00C1D5). Cross-system Pantone matching is approximate; for color-critical print work, verify with a physical Pantone guide.

What is the closest RAL color to Cyan 4?

The closest RAL Classic reference to Cyan 4 by ΔE2000 distance is RAL 6027 (Light green, #84C3BE). RAL is a German industrial coating standard commonly used for paint, powder coat, and architectural specification.

What is the complementary color of Cyan 4?

The complementary color (180° opposite on the HSL color wheel) of Cyan 4 is #DB503D. Use it for high-contrast accents, error states, or call-to-action pairings.
